 Abstract

A simple, sensitive and accurate Development and validation of analytical method for estimation of Efonidipine, Telmisartan and Chlorthalidone in synthetic. A reversed-phase high performance liquid chromatography method is developed and validated for the determination of three drugs. With the help of RP- HPLC it gives us to good resolution and better separation of three drugs. The separation was conducted by using Cybersil C18 column (250mm x 4.6mm x 5?m) with mobile phase consisting Potassium dihydrogen phosphate: Methanol: Acetonitrile (30:30:40 v/v/v) (pH :3). The mobile phase was delivered at flow rate of 1.0 ml/min. The eluent was monitored at wavelength 254 nm and found a sharp and symmetrical peak of Efonidipine, Telmisartan and Chlorthalidone were found to be 6.88 min, 5.34 and 8.25 min respectively. The method was validated for linearity, accuracy, precision, system suitability. The method was found to be linear over the concentration range for the drugs efonidipine (5-30 ?g/ml), telmisartan (10-60 ?g/ml) and chlorthalidone (10-60 ?g/ml) with coefficient R2 for EFO (0.9962) TEL (0.9947), and CTD (0.9992). Therefore, proposed method can be successfully used for routine analysis of Efonidipine, Telmisartan and Chlorthalidone in bulk as well as synthetic mixture.

 Abstract

Tourism is one of the biggest and fastest-growing economic sectors in the global economy and has significant environmental, cultural, social, and economic effects, both positive and negative. Pilgrimage tourism is one of the pre-requisites of achieving sustainable development which can be taken as a remedy to manage tourism effects. This paper focuses on the sustainable development of pilgrimage tourism in Varanasi situated in the state of Uttar Pradesh. Varanasi has been a tourist spot due to its magnificently diverse religious tourist potential and rich cultural heritage. The main objectives of the study are the formation of tourist areas, to highlight the factors creating hindrances in sustainable tourism development and suggest suitable measures for sustainable development of pilgrimage tourism in Varanasi. A field based systematic survey was carried out at selected tourism spots in the study area. The result of the study brings feasible suggestions and recommendations for further development of tourism in this region.

 Abstract

This study was designed to asses cervical ROM in those who are diagnosed with CGH using diagnostic criteria by IHS and positive flexion-rotation test in IT professionals. This was analytical study that included 30 samples working in IT for more than a year. The participants were assessed for CGH using diagnostic criteria by questionnaire. The cervical ROM and cervical flexion rotation test (CFRT) was assessed using goniometer. This concluded that, the participants who found positive for CGH showed decreased cervical ROM.

 Abstract

Every investor wishes to get a good return for their investments, as they invested from their savings. There are so many investment avenues available for the investors of which the stock market is considered to be one of the most rewarding avenues even though the higher risk is involved. Due to higher risk in stock market the investors need to make proper analysis that helps them to get an idea about the stock market behaviour and risk return benefits of the shares and the industries that gives more returns. In this context, the present study has been undertaken to analyse the risk and return of select automobile companies which is listed in Bombay Stock exchange. The automobile sector plays an important role in Indian economy. The contribution of auto sectors towards GDP and tax revenues are 4.7% and 19% respectively. The secondary data have been collected for the period of ten years from 2009 to 2019 for the following selected companies Bajaj, TVS, Hero, M&M, Maruti, Tata, Eicher and Ashok Leyland. The statistical tools have been applied for anlaysing the data. From the analysis, it is found that among all other companies Eicher and TVS motors is the best company to invest because it gives more returns with minimum risk.

 Abstract

"A FINGERPRINT BASED VOTING MACHINE" is used exclusively in this study. This concept's main purpose is to guarantee security while also overcoming the limitations of traditional voting systems. During the customer registration procedure, the voters' details, as well as their fingerprints, are first kept in the serial monitor. In this situation, the serial monitor acts as a database. The voter desires to place their finger on the polling booth's module, which will allow an impression of their finger to be taken and used as identification. After that, the imprint is sent to the controlling unit for confirmation. The microcontroller collects the voter's information and compares it to information saved earlier in the voter's registration process. If the statistics match the existing data, the voters are permitted to vote. Push buttons are used to operate the voting system manually. The welcome instructions, as well as the parties, are presented on the LCD. On the other hand, the voter information and results are displayed on the screen. The goal of this research is to offer a new voting system that uses biometrics to prevent rigging and improve the accuracy and speed of the process. Because each human's thumb imprint has a unique pattern, the system uses thumb impressions to identify voters. As a result, it would be more effective than current voting methods.

 Abstract

Gestational Diabetes is defined as any degree of glucose intolerance first recognized during pregnancy. The presence of GDM in pregnancy complicates the course of pregnancy and is associated with adverse feto-maternal outcome. A large number of pregnant women are affected by GDM in pregnancy. Different countries employ different diagnostic criteria to diagnose GDM depending on the resource setting of the country. As the number of pregnancies being affected with diabetes is increasing, the purpose of this study is to compare the screening criteria DIPSI with universally accepted IADPSG criteria in diagnosing GDM.
